Transaction 2702617374a4f2c3cf694bdc132ff9ee7691c5d33e326162aea0fb69fdbc3393
1 Input
1 Output
-
2702617374a4f2c3cf694bdc132ff9ee7691c5d33e326162aea0fb69fdbc3393:0
- value
- 6583182
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5854c3199cd0cb774721041aa05a55893754d23 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PPCEgTU9CDPn6Ds4pzSR2bW3fyM6i3h3J